A Caribbean property specialist has unveiled a collection of seven of the plushest homes sites in Barbados, newly built and offering investment opportunities.
Specialists 7th Heaven Properties launched the series and dubbed them ‘The Barbados Collection’, featuring newly built apartment property in condo hotels and villas.
Highlights include a studio apartment at £267,400 on the south coast and homes in a planned luxury community called Apes Hill, featuring a selection of villas from £1.3 million ($1.9 million).
Divided into eight neighbourhoods with stunning views, the Apes Hill site is nearly 1,000 ft above sea level and features property flanked by golf course holes.
Managing director of 7th Heaven, Walter Zephirin said: “The properties we selected for inclusion in ‘The Barbados Collection’ offer buyers excellent opportunities to invest in beautiful real estate in one of the Caribbean’s most sought-after locations.
“Barbados has been one of the region’s most popular destinations for years and offers outstanding natural beauty, excellent long-term potential and old world charm.”
Also on the list are three-bed villa homes at Silver Sands, a seafront property project with private access to a white sand beach and a glass tiled pool, going for £2,194,048 ($3,233,242).
Owners of homes in Barbados could benefit from an expected tourism boost for the island after the ‘Gourmet’ and ‘VIP’ cards launched by the local tourist board proved a big success, according to Opodo.
